Teacher Development & Methodology is the 156th most popular major in the country with 6,165 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across Oklahoma, there were 46 teacher development and methodology gra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 11 teacher development and methodology graduates with average earnings and debt of $75,022 and $0 respectively.

The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their teacher development and methodology program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.

Out of the 1 schools in the Schools for a Doctorate Highly Focused on Teacher Development & Methodology Major in Oklahoma that were part of this year’s ranking, University of Oklahoma Norman Campus landed the #1 spot on the list. This large school is located in Norman, Oklahoma, and it awarded 11 doctorate’s teacher development and methodology degrees in 2020-2021.

The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 3.3%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%. The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 87%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year.
